PUEBLO ALTO TRAIL
Distance: Loop Trail5.4 mi. (8.7 km.)
Pueblo Alto3.2 mi. (5.2 km.)
Pueblo Bonito Overlook1.6 mi. (2.6 km.)
Elevation Gain: 350'
Time Required for Total Loop: 4-5 hours
Trailhead AccessPueblo del Arroyo Parking Area
Please Note; for your safety and that of others, Do Not Park Along the Road.
Leading to the prehistoric structures of Pueblo Alto and New Alto, this trail provides excellent panoramic views of the canyon floor and surrounding mesas. The route also includes outstanding overlooks of Pueblo Bonito and Chetro Ketl, as well as views of Jackson staircase and prehistoric farming terraces. Several prehistoric roads converge at Pueblo Alto and sections of them are discernible by slight variations in the vegetation.
PENASCO BLANCO TRAIL
Distance: 6.4 mi. (10.3 km.)
Elevation Gain: 150'
Time Required4-5 hours
Trailhead ACCESSPueblo del Arroyo Parking Area
This trail leads to one of the earliest pueblos in the canyon. Construction at Penasco Blanco, Pueblo Bonito, and Una Vida began around the middle of the ninth century. From the trail, a large concentration of petroglyphs can be seen along the canyon wall. The route also includes a spur trail to the "Supernova Pictograph" site.
Wijiji Trail
Distance: 3.0 mi. (4.8 km.) round-trip
Elevation Gain: Insignificant
Time Required2-3 hours
Trailhead AccessWijiji Parking Area
This trail leads to the prehistoric pueblo of Wijiji, which was built around A.D. 1100. Wijiji differs from sites like Pueblo Bonito and Chetro Ketl in that it appears to have been built in one construction sequence rather than several. Evidence of this single sequence can be seen in the exceptional symmetry of the building plan and the uniformity of the masonry. To the northeast of the structure along the canyon wall there is a small rock art panel.
South Mesa Trail
Distance: To Tsin Kletzin3.0 mi. (4.8 km.)
Total Loop4.1 mi. (6.6 km.)
Elevation Gain450'
Time Required2-3 hours for Tsin Kletzin
3-4 hours for full loop
Trailhead AccessCasa Rinconada Trail or from behind Pueblo del Arroyo. This route provides several excellent vistas of South Gap and leads the hiker 100' higher than any other point along the canyon trails. In the spring and summer, an abundant array of wildflowers enhances the beauty of the landscape. Tsin Kletzin dates from the early A.D. 1100s. The view from this building overlooks Pueblo Alto, Penasco Blanco, Kin Klizhin, and Kin Ya'a.
